This technical report provides an overview of thermal analysis techniques used in the pharmaceutical industry, specifically focusing on Thermogravimetry (TGA), Differential Scanning Calorimetry (DSC), and Sorption Analysis (SA). It outlines the significance of these methods in ensuring the quality and stability of pharmaceutical products. The report discusses the importance of analyzing raw materials during incoming goods inspection and highlights the analytical tasks involved in the development of new active ingredients. It details how TGA measures mass changes in samples under controlled conditions, providing insights into thermal stability and material composition. Additionally, it explains the role of DSC in determining heat flow and material parameters such as melting temperature and compatibility. The report also emphasizes the relevance of sorption analysis in understanding moisture interactions and their effects on material stability.
